Madhya Pradesh CM Urges Caution After Tragic Fire Incident

Madhya Pradesh Chief Minister Mohan Yadav expressed concern over the use of electrical appliances like air conditioners in enclosed spaces, emphasizing the importance of regular electrical circuit inspections in homes and commercial places. He highlighted the need for caution during electric vehicle charging, especially at night, stressing the safety of families. Yadav mentioned the recent tragic fire incident in Indore where eight family members died due to a fire following an explosion at an EV charging point.

Taking cognizance of the Indore fire tragedy, the state government, in collaboration with experts, aims to find solutions to prevent such incidents in the future. Chief Minister Yadav, who visited the families of the victims in Indore, extended his condolences over the loss of lives. He assured that discussions with experts will be held to prevent the recurrence of such tragedies, emphasizing the importance of necessary preventive measures.

During a meeting with Chief Minister Yadav, Saurabh Pugalia, the eldest son of the house owner where the fire occurred, clarified that the fire resulted from a short circuit at an electric pole, not the vehicle charging process itself. He criticized the delayed arrival of the fire department, suggesting that timely intervention could have saved lives. The tragic incident in Indore claimed the lives of eight individuals, including two minors, due to a massive fire in a three-story building following an explosion during the charging of an electric car.
